#d06d5b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#d06d5b is composed of 81.6% red, 42.7% green and 35.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 47.6% magenta, 56.3% yellow and 18.4% black. It has a hue angle of 9.2 degrees, a saturation of 55.5% and a lightness of 58.6%. #d06d5b color hex could be obtained by blending #ffdab6 with #a10000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6666.

#d06d5b color description : Moderate red.

#d06d5b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#d06d5b has RGB values of R:208, G:109, B:91 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.48, Y:0.56,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 13659483.

Shades and Tints of #d06d5b

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040101 is the darkest color, while #fcf5f3 is the lightest one.

Tones of #d06d5b

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#979494 is the less saturated color, while #f95132 is the most saturated one.
